What factor may lead to denture stomatitis and irritation of palatal tissues?

Explanation:
Continuous denture wear keeps the mucosa under constant coverage, preventing tissue rest and cleansing. The palatal tissues are exposed to persistent pressure and friction from the denture, which causes microtrauma and inflammation. In this warm, moist, low-oxygen environment, Candida species can overgrow, leading to denture stomatitis and irritation of the palatal tissues. Removing dentures periodically allows tissue recovery, improves airflow, and lets saliva help cleanse and protect the mucosa, reducing risk. While denture adhesive can affect retention, it does not inherently cause stomatitis when used properly. Regular dental checkups and adequate saliva aid in maintaining fit, hygiene, lubrication, and antimicrobial protection, making them protective factors rather than causes.
